Creating roleplay agents — overview

Learn all the ways to create roleplay agents in Outdoo—from existing calls, prompts, templates, files, variations, and more—with links to detailed guides for each method.

This article gives an overview of every way to create a Roleplay Agent in Outdoo, with links to detailed step-by-step guides for each method.

Creation methods

Method

Description

Best for

Guide

From Existing Calls

Upload a call or connect Gong. Outdoo extracts buyer patterns and creates a Digital Twin.

Most realistic training

Creating agents from existing calls

Create Variations

Auto-generate new personas, scenarios, and voices from an existing agent.

Scaling training volume

Creating roleplay agent variations

Clone for New Sales Stages

Reuse an existing agent for discovery, pricing, or negotiation.

Consistency across the sales cycle

Cloning and reusing roleplay agents

From Prompt

Create an agent instantly using a short written description of the buyer and scenario.

Fast persona creation

Creating agents from prompts

From Template

Start from ready-made templates designed for cold calls, discovery, demos, and other common scenarios.

Structured, repeatable simulations

Creating agents using templates

From File or Resource

Attach product docs, playbooks, or call scripts to ground the agent in real materials.

Factual accuracy, persona fidelity

Creating agents from files or resources

From existing calls

Use a real sales call to build the most accurate simulation. Outdoo automatically extracts buyer personality, objections, tone, and communication patterns from the recording. Ideal for SDR cold call reviews, AE discovery calls, pricing conversations, and customer success renewals.

From prompt

Write a short description including the persona details, company, mindset, and call context. Outdoo generates a complete agent with persona traits, objections, emotional tone, and conversation style. The fastest way to create a new agent.

From file or resource

Attach product documentation, a pricing guide, a sales playbook, or any other document from your Resources library. The agent uses the content to stay accurate on facts and align to your specific messaging.

Variations and cloning

Once you have an agent that works, you do not need to build from scratch for every variation. Use Variations to generate new personas, scenarios, or voice styles from an existing agent. Use Clone to take the same buyer persona into a different sales stage — discovery, demo, pricing, negotiation — updating the objections and scorecard for each context.

Organising your agents

Folders help you group agents by product line, skill area, learning path, or cohort. You can share entire folders with your team or attach them to Courses and Call Blitz sessions.

See Organising roleplay agents into folders.